![](https://img-blog.csdnimg.cn/2019122212162424.jpg?x-oss-process=image/resize,m_fixed,h_224,w_224)
Handler杂谈
结合handler,分探讨各种常见的问题
AFinalStone
这个作者很懒,什么都没留下…
展开
-
Handler杂谈【二】Handler的用法及解析
原文地址:https://www.jianshu.com/p/7cdf2c2ed354在Handler机制中,每一个线程有一个Looper,Looper.loop()一直无限循环,为什么没有造成ANR呢?首先要知道造成ANR的基本原因是:1.在5秒内没有响应输入的事件(例如,按键按下,屏幕触摸)2.BroadcastReceiver在10秒内没有执行完毕造成以上两点的原因有很多,比如在主...原创 2019-12-22 11:42:40 · 675 阅读 · 0 评论 -
Handler杂谈【一】Andriod 中的异步消息机制
一、Andriod 中的异步消息处理主要由四个部分组成,Message、Handler、MessageQueue和Looper.1.Message:Message是在线程之间传递的消息,它可以在内部携带少量的信息,用于在不同线程之间交换数据。 Message的what、arg1和arg2字段可以携带一些整型数据,使用obj字段可以携带一个Object对象。 这样在大部分情况下,使用者就不需要再做原创 2017-07-28 14:00:51 · 411 阅读 · 0 评论